To create a virtual LAN adapter in
Windows
®
Vista
1. Launch the Realtek VLAN &
Teaming Utility.
2. Choose one adapter to create the virtual LAN adapter, and then click VLAN.
Click OK to close the message
window and nish creating the
virtual LAN adapter.
3. Click Start > Control Panel >
Network and Sharing Center,
and then click Manage network
connections from the left Tasks
list.
Right-click the virtual LAN adapter
icon and select Properties.
4. Conduct necessary settings for the
virtual LAN adapter, and then click
Congure.
5. Click the Advanced tab in the
Realtek Virtual Miniport Driver for
VLAN (NDIS 6.0) Properties window and conduct necessary VLAN settings.
Close all windows when nished.
To remove a virtual LAN adapter in Windows
®
Vista
1. Launch the Realtek VLAN & Teaming Utility.
2. Click Remove to remove the existing virtual LAN adapter.
